Title:
GRINDING DEVICE

Abstract:

PURPOSE: To prevent the generation of vibration during grinding operation by providing holding-bodies for holding workpieces within faces spaced a specified distance apart and opposed each other with grinding medium fluid held between the faces, and driving the holding bodies to move the workpieces within the faces at a specified speed.

CONSTITUTION: When rotary plates 25a and 2b on whose side surfaces plural workpieces 1 are mounted by means of workpiece-holding plates 2 are driven to rotate by an electric motor 21, flows of a grinding medium fluid 4 along the tangential direction of the rotary plates 25a, 25b are produced on the outer peripheries of the rotary plates 25a, 25b. At the portion where the rotary plates 25a and 25b are close to each other and spaced a specified distance apart, the flows of the grinding medium fluid 4 run in the opposite directions, so that these flows of the grinding medium fluid 4 collide with each other, and at this time, the grinding medium fluid 4 strikes the workpieces 1, thereby grinding the workpieces 1. In this case, since the grinding medium fluid 4 uniformly strikes each workpiece 1, each workpiece 1 is uniformly and specularly ground. This method does not utilize the fluid-bearing condition, so that the vibration due to this condition can be eliminated.
